Miami Gardens has a large stock of single-family homes from the 1960s–1980s where original HVAC systems have been replaced multiple times but duct systems retain the original flex duct — aging flex duct with fibreglass liner is a known mold substrate.
The community's proximity to NW Miami-Dade Canal gives western sections elevated groundwater levels after heavy rain events.
Common mold types in Miami Gardens
- Aspergillus/Penicillium (flex duct liner and HVAC components)
- Cladosporium (interior surfaces with humidity excursions)
- Stachybotrys (ground moisture in slab-on-grade homes near canal)
